Believe it.. but the thing is I like N/A over boost. You just have to experience the clutch to see what I'm talking about. With boost the car feels slow after a while and the top end is kind of blah.. (Its the reason why most G's or Z's that go high boost end up getting sold) with this assembly the revs are amazing and going through the gears on twisty roads compares to nothing else.. mated with a good exhaust and expension mods you would almost believe you are in something exotic.

The cost is.. its hard as hell to launch. The clutch cannot be slipped very much and you WILL stall for a few days.

I guess i should also state that the stock assembly is like 48lbs.. this altogether is 16lbs.
